I Will Lay upon You None Other Burden. — A
respite promised the church, if we rightly
apprehend, from the burden so long her
portion, — the weight of papal oppression. It
cannot be applied to the reception of new
truths; for truth is not a burden to any
accountable being. But the days of tribulation
that came upon that church, were to be
shortened for the elect’s sake. Matthew 24:22.
